Senior Director II, Integrated Marketing - East
Yesterday• Atlanta, GA
Location: Atlanta, Georgia or East Region, USA
The Senior Director, Integrated Marketing East provides strategic leadership for the development and execution of all market activation programs and actions within assigned brands, geographies and/or channels, analyzing and translating brand plans into effective market activation. This role partners with key internal and external stakeholders to maximize market activation, driving successful activation and implementation of programs and initiatives to achieve targeted value and growth objectives.
KEY WORKING PARAMETERS
Focus, Scope, & Impact:
- Leads a team of regional integrated marketers focused on assets and franchise relationships
- Represents the Category OU platforms/programming/innovation in Governance Routines at region and aligning bottlers & customers to support the plans
- Responsible for assessing and analyzing consumer insights and passions, as well as, leveraging industry intel and knowledge to create core marketing strategies to drive revenue growth and enable OU's achieve business plan
- Enhances commercial priorities with compelling sales and marketing platforms within the regions (by bottler by market) amplifying the national plans with the local marketing assets
- Responsible for activating local market assets and engaging in the Collaborative Business Planning process creating key strategies that reinforce The Coca-Cola Partner Commitment with those partners
- Leads regional customer marketing with our larger regional retail customers within the region supporting their core strategies via the Collaborative Business Plan
- Collaborate with Creative Operations to deliver regional and customer creative marketing content
- Key focus is on long term (3-5 year) brand preference building, increasing our per cap consumption and revenue and creating long term, winning strategic plans with our bottlers and customers
